h1 {
font-weight: bold;
font-size: small;
color: #442580;
}

h2 {
font-weight: bold;
font-size: small;
color: #442580;
}

hr {
height: 0px;
width: 100%;
border-bottom: solid 1px #FFD67E;
}

#NewsCompFull a {
color: #330099;
}

#NewsCompFull a:hover {
color: #A476FF;
}

#join {
border-top: solid 1px #C6BDD8;
border-right: solid 1px #C6BDD8;
border-left: solid 1px #C6BDD8;
border-bottom: solid 2px #C6BDD8;
padding: 3px;
background-color: #FBF2FF;
}

#joinblurb {
border-top: solid 1px #FFD67E;
border-right: solid 1px #FFD67E;
border-bottom: solid 2px #FFD67E;
padding: 3px;
}

#clubk {
background-color: #ffffff;
width: 100%;
margin-top: 5px;
border: solid #FF8805 1px;
}

.headerbg {
background-color: #442582;
font-weight: bold;
font-size: medium;
color: #FFEE00;
padding-left: 0px;
padding-right: 0px;
padding-top: 4px;
padding-bottom: 0px;
border: solid #000000 1px;
}

.signup td {
font-size: xx-small;
}

.signup form {
margin: 0px;
padding: 0px;
}

.signup input {
width: 100px;
}

.submit {
background-color: #E1D1FF;
border: solid #8571AC 1px;
}

.subbox {
background-color: #442580;
padding: 5px;
}

.formtext {
background-color: #FFEF00;
border-bottom: solid #FFBA00 1px;
padding: 3px;
}

.formfield {
background-color: #FF8805;
border-bottom: solid #9E0B00 1px;
padding: 3px;
}

.column {
padding: 15px 0px 0px 25px;
}

.columnbox {
margin-bottom: 5px;
}

.boxspacetop {
padding-bottom: 1px;
}

.boxspacebase {
padding-top: 1px;
}

.boxborder {
border: dashed #F68220 1px;
padding: 5px;
}

body {
background-color: #442580;
scrollbar-3dlight-color: #442580;
scrollbar-arrow-color: #F7E906;
scrollbar-base-color: #F58220;
scrollbar-darkshadow-color: #442580;
scrollbar-face-color: #F58220;
scrollbar-highlight-color: #F7E906;
scrollbar-shadow-color: #F35406;
scrollbar-track-color: #442580;
}

body, td, div, p, span {
color: #000000;
font-family: verdana;
font-size: x-small;
}

a {
color:#F58220;
font-family:verdana,arial;
}

a:hover	{
color:#F5B620;
}

ul {
list-style-image: url(http://www.nzsquash.co.nz/myimages/bullet.gif);
list-style-type: circle;
}

.small {
color: #A188D2;
font-family: verdana;
font-size: xx-small;
}

.bgstatic { 
background-image: url("http://www.squashnz.co.nz/templateimages/players.gif");
background-repeat: no-repeat;
background-position: top right;
}

.bgstatic2 { 
background-image: url("http://www.squashnz.co.nz/templateimages/nav-purplecurve.gif");
background-repeat: no-repeat;
background-position: bottom left;
}

.subnav	{
color: #442580;
font-size: xx-small;
padding: 3px 3px 6px 10px;
}

#navigator {
width: auto;
text-align: center;
}

.button1 {
font-size: x-small;
font-weight: bold;
text-align: left;
margin-bottom: 0px;
margin-top: 0px;
margin-right: 0px;
margin-left: 0px;
background-image: url("http://www.squashnz.co.nz/templateimages/nav-bullet-button1.gif");
background-repeat: no-repeat;
background-position: center left;
}

.button1 a {
color: #F58220;
font-family: verdana;
font-size: 100%;
padding: 3px 3px 3px 15px;
text-decoration: none;
width: 100%;
display: block;
}

.button1 a:hover {
color: #D94D00;
background-image: url("http://www.squashnz.co.nz/templateimages/nav-bullet-button1-ov.gif");
background-repeat: no-repeat;
background-position: center left;
}

.button2 {
font-size: x-small;
font-weight: bold;
text-align: left;
margin-bottom: 0px;
margin-top: 0px;
margin-right: 0px;
margin-left: 0px;
background-image: url("http://www.squashnz.co.nz/templateimages/nav-bullet-print.gif");
background-repeat: no-repeat;
background-position: center left;
}

.button2 a {
color: #666666;
font-family: verdana;
font-size: 100%;
padding: 3px 3px 3px 15px;
text-decoration: none;
width: 100%;
display: block;
}

.button2 a:hover {
color: #333333;
background-image: url("http://www.squashnz.co.nz/templateimages/nav-bullet-print-ov.gif");
background-repeat: no-repeat;
background-position: center left;
}

.currentpage {
font-size: x-small;
font-weight: bold;
text-align: left;
margin-bottom: 0px;
margin-top: 0px;
margin-right: 0px;
margin-left: 0px;
background-image: url("http://www.squashnz.co.nz/templateimages/nav-bullet-current.gif");
background-repeat: no-repeat;
background-position: center left;
}

.currentpage a {
color: #000000;
font-family: verdana;
font-size: 100%;
padding: 3px 3px 3px 15px;
text-decoration: none;
width: 100%;
display: block;
}

.currentpage a:hover {
color: #000000;
background-image: url("http://www.squashnz.co.nz/templateimages/nav-bullet-current-ov.gif");
background-repeat: no-repeat;
background-position: center left;
}

.submen {
font-size: x-small;
font-weight: bold;
text-align: left;
margin-bottom: 0px;
margin-top: 0px;
margin-right: 0px;
margin-left: 0px;
background-image: url("http://www.squashnz.co.nz/templateimages/nav-bullet-submen.gif");
background-repeat: no-repeat;
background-position: center left;
}

.submen a {
color: #A192BF;
font-family: verdana;
font-size: 100%;
padding: 3px 3px 3px 17px;
text-decoration: none;
width: 100%;
display: block;
}

.submen a:hover {
color: #442580;
background-image: url("http://www.squashnz.co.nz/templateimages/nav-bullet-submen-ov.gif");
background-repeat: no-repeat;
background-position: center left;
}

#searchhead {
	position: absolute;
	top: 89px;
	right: 0px;
	z-index: +1;
	width: 235px;
	}

#searchhead td {
	color: #fff;
	}